EXCEPTIONAL HEALTHCARE is Hiring an ER Registered Nurse - Nights Near Lubbock, TX

*No COVID-19 Vaccination Requirements*

The Emergency Room Nurse provides direct and indirect patient care in the emergency care setting and provides care that reflects initiative, flexibility, and responsibility indicative of professional expectation with a minimum of supervision. The Emergency Room Nurse can triage safely, rapidly, and accurately, every patient that enters the emergency care system.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Determine priorities of care based on physical and psychosocial needs, as well as factors
  • influencing patient flow through the system.
  • Communicate with Emergency Department physicians about changes in patient's status, symptomatology, and results of diagnostic studies.
  • Able to respond quickly and accurately to changes in condition or response to treatment.
  • Maintain awareness of current ER operational policies and procedures which impact position responsibilities.
  • Demonstrate current comprehensive and professional knowledge and skills in conformation with recognized nursing standards including the Patient Bill of Rights standards for patient care and the Nurse Practice Act.
  • Provide direct patient care, evaluate outcomes, consult with other specialists as required and adjust nursing care processes as indicated to ensure optimal patient care.
  • Able to perform a head-to-toe assessment on all patients and reassessments as per policy, including pediatric, adolescent, and geriatric patients and the general patient population.
  • Able to use triage process to ensure timely and appropriate care to patients and accurately assign triage categories.
  • Able to adequately assess and reassess pain, utilize appropriate pain management techniques, and educate the patient and family regarding pain management.
  • Able to monitor hemodynamic status of patient and correctly interpret the results.
  • Demonstrate knowledge of cardiac monitoring to identify dysrhythmias.
  • Able to perform waived testing (point-of-care testing) per Clinical Laboratory's and according to patient care unit's policies and procedures.
  • Able to interpret the results of waived tests and take appropriate action on waived test results.
  • Maintain current knowledge of medications and their correct administration based on age of the patient and his/her clinical condition.
  • Maintain accurate and continued nursing documentation including patient histories, conditions, treatments, responses, and assessment of changes.
  • Perform all aspects of patient care in an environment that optimizes patient safety and reduce the likelihood of medical/health care errors.
  • Interact professionally with patient and family and involve patient and family in the formation of the plan of care.
  • Formulate a teaching plan based on identified learning needs and evaluate effectiveness of learning, including family in teaching as appropriate.
  • Maintain a safe, comfortable, and therapeutic environment for patients and families in accordance with ER standards.
  • Ensure an adequate stock of supplies and proper functioning of equipment.
  • Assist in cost containment through appropriate ordering and conserving of supplies and equipment.

Education and Experience:

  • Graduate of an accredited school of nursing
  • 1 years of Emergency, Room Registered Nurse experience.

Computer Skills:

  • Basic computer skills
  • EHR Documentation via EPOWERdoc

Certificates and Licenses:

  • Current RN licenseĀ 
  • Current BLS Certification
  • Current ACLS Certification
  • Current PALS Certification

Shift Schedule:

  • 12 hour shift
  • All shift
  • Weekend availability
  • Monday to Friday
  • Holidays
